- Abstract
- The increasing complexity of medical care and growing patient awareness have resulted in a consistent rise in the number of medical disputes, highlighting the urgent necessity for fair and expert medical evaluations. The Ethics and Legislation Committee of the Korean Society of Gastroenterology (KSG) is involved in the systematic management and evaluation of medico-legal cases in the field of gastroenterology. The committee is composed of a multidisciplinary group of experienced specialists and legal professionals and utilizes a thorough, multi-tiered review process appropriate to the seriousness of each case. The committee initiated the establishment of advanced educational programs in 2024 to facilitate the further development of the expertise of its members. Furthermore, the committee has been actively publishing casebooks on medical ethics and disputes to educate members of the KSG on how to prevent legal risks. This article provides a comprehensive overview of the core activities of the KSG Ethics and Legislation Committee, including its history, systematic appraisal process, educational programs, and publications. It illustrates how these integrated efforts help foster a safer and more trustworthy medical environment for physicians and the public.
